The efficacy and safety of Mirazid in treatment of human hymenolepiosis were carried out in a rural village in Talkha Center [Dakahlia G.]. Kato thick smear stool examination showed 51 cases of Hymenolepis nana [9 of them had concomitant parasitosis], two cases of H. diminuta. Mirazid was given in a dose of 10 mg/kg/d for nine consecutive days an hour before breakfast for hymenolepiosis cases, as capsule for adults and suppository for children. All cases were subjected to history taking before treatment and six weeks post-treatment and stool examination was repeated as well weekly for six weeks post-treatment. There was overt clinical improvement. Side effects were negligible. Parasitologic cure rate was 40/41 or 95.2% for H. nana one week post-treatment, and 100% for H. diminuta one week post-treatment, up to six weeks follow-up for all treated patients. Two unresponded H. nana patients were cured by another Mirazid course

The encysted metacercariae [EMC] of heterophyids in the fish species; Mugil caphalus, M. capito, M. auratus, Oreochromis, n.niloticus [=Tilapia nilotica], and Tilapia zillii trapped brackish and fresh water fishes were isolated by the artificial digestion method and identified. The EMC by morphometric analysis proved to be seven phenotypical distinct types. Cross-matched seven groups of clean laboratory bred puppies each was experimentally infected with a distinct EMC type. The recovered adult flukes were compatible to seven species of six genera of family Heterophyidae. These were Heterophyes heterophyes, H. aequalis, Pygidiopsis genata, Haplorchis yokogawai, Prohemostomum vivax, Phagicola sp. and Stictodora sp. The EMC of the seven heterophyids were recovered from all the brackish water fishes, M. caphalus, M. capito, M. auratus, O. niloticus and T. zillii. On the other hand, the EMC of P. genata, Haplorchis yokogawai and Phagicola sp. were recovered only from the fresh water fish, O. niloticus and T. zillii. All the EMC was re-described and photographed

This study was carried out on 70 Albino rats classified into 3 groups. Group I, of 10 rats [control], Group II, of 30 rats infected with T. spiralis, Group III, of 30 rats, infected with T. spiralis and immunosuppressed with dexamethasone. Rats were sacrificed on the 8th,15th and 21th days postinfection. At each day of sacrification, histological examination, adult worms count, goblet cells and mucosal mast cells count were done. The results showed that in GII there were shortening of villi, prominent lengthening of the crypts, high significant increase of goblet cells and mucosal mast cells numbers during worms expulsion and most of adult worms were expelled at 15th day post infection. GIII, showed marked atrophy of the villi and crypts, high significant decrease of goblet cells and mucosal mast cells numbers and significant delay of adult worms expulsion. The authors concluded that goblet cells and mucosal mast cells play an important role in T. spiralis expulsion and immunosuppression led to dalay expulsion of T. spiralis

Schistosoma mansoni glutathione S-transferase [SmGST] and Fasciola gigantica glutathione S-transferase [FgGST] were purified from adult worms homogenate by affinity chromatography. An assessment of both SmGST and FgGST as candidate vaccines was done by comparing vaccinated guinea pigs groups challenged with F. gigantica metacercariae with the control group in terms of worm load, pathological changes in liver tissue and the survival rate of the animals. A decrease in mortality rate was best reported with FgGST 15 ug dose, while no significant decrease in worm load was reported with any vaccination. The pathological changes in liver tissue of vaccinated and non- vaccinated animals were similar

Serum samples of fifteen women with abortion [sporadic or repeated] were serologically examined for Toxoplasma antibodies [IgM and IgG] using the microparticle enzyme immunoassay [MEIA]. A histopathological study of the obtained placentas was also done. It was found that all cases were negative for Toxoplasma IgM, while five cases were positive for Toxoplasma IgG. The histopathological findings of examined placentas showed villitis and calcifications in 20% of Toxoplasma IgG positive cases. Hydropic degeneration was also observed in 100% and 70% of Toxoplasma IgG positive and negative cases, respectively. The difference between the two groups was statistically insignificant

This study was carried out on the sera of fifteen Strongyloidiasis patients, twenty-five cases with other helminthic infections and five cases free from parasitic infections [control]. Enzyme immunoblot transfer assay [EIBT] was used to assess IgG response against the different fractions of Strongyloides stercoralis filariform larval crude soluble antigen separated by sodium dodecyl sulfate- polyacrylamide gel electrophoresis [SDS-PAGE]. In the immunoblot, all sera of 15 strongyloidiasis patients disclosed IgG antibodies reactivity against immunogenic bands having molecular weights. Five immunodominant antigenic bands of 66, 50, 41, 38 and 31 KDa were commonly recognized by the strongyloidiasis sera IgG suggesting that these antigenic components may be suitable for specific immunodiagnosis of human strongyloidiasis
